The last time we ran into Ben Heck, the tinkerer extraordinaire was waxing poetic at Maker Faire about the Raspberry Pi and cheese curds. One more thing he also talked about, however, was his latest 3D printer project, which he now explains in greater detail in the latest episode of the Ben Heck Show. Improvements made to the device include use of a Birdstruder for easier access to the filament and the ability print off an SD card if you don’t have a computer handy. The 3D printer also sports an expanded 200-square-millimeter print area with a solid copper cover for added sturdiness and accuracy. As usual, size matters for Mr. Heckendorn so the device got a boost in portability, now neatly folding James Bond-like into a briefcase that measures 18 x 14 x 4.2 inches. Interested in a briefcase printer of your own? Well, Heckendorn mentioned during the Maker Faire interview that he’s already working on an improved version and thinking about putting it up on Kickstarter so hope springs eternal. NTP Inc., a patent-holding company that won a $612.5 million settlement from RIM in 2006, has struck again with a settlement involving 13 of the biggest companies in the tech industry.
NTP, noting that it holds eight US patents “relating to the delivery of electronic mail over wireless systems,” today said it reached a settlement with 13 companies representing just about everyone involved in building and selling smartphones or delivering e-mail to them. The 13 companies are AT&T, Verizon Wireless, Sprint Nextel, T-Mobile, Apple, HTC, Motorola Mobility, Palm, LG, Samsung, Google, Microsoft, and Yahoo.
“The signed agreement provides broad coverage under NTP’s patent portfolio to all of the companies,” NTP said. Consequently, “all pending litigation between NTP and these companies will be dismissed.”

In the 1930s engineer Adolf Busemann conceived of a supersonic biplane that produced no sonic boom-the shock waves would bounce off the plane’s two wings at opposing angles, nullifying each other. But the design created so much drag that the plane wouldn’t have been able to fly. Now two groups are trying to improve the concept with computer simulations. Engineers at Japan’s Tohoku University devised wings with shifting flaps that adjust for drag at different speeds. And researchers from MIT and Stanford University widened the air channel between the wings and tilted their leading and trailing edges. If either design gets built, it could be the first supersonic biplane to take off.

One of the biggest changes ever made to WiFi is coming in the next year with a new standard supporting the 60GHz band, powering much faster transmissions than are possible in the existing 2.4GHz and 5GHz bands. All that’s needed are some chips, and products to put them in.
Slowly but surely, the chipmakers embracing 60GHz technology are making their plans known. The latest is Marvell, which today announced a partnership with startup Wilocity to make tri-band chips that will use all three bands. That will allow consumer devices to connect to existing WiFi networks while also taking advantage of the super-fast 60GHz band for high-speed data transfer and high-quality media streaming. Under the developing 802.11ad standard, 60GHz transmissions can hit 7Gbps.
Wilocity already has a partnership with Qualcomm Atheros, Qualcomm’s networking subsidiary, to build tri-band chips. Those are expected to come out by the end of this year and focus on the PC notebook market—for example a laptop bundled with a remote docking station. The partnership with Marvell won’t result in shipping products until 2013, but Wilocity’s VP of Marketing, Mark Grodzinsky, told us that the Marvell/Wilocity chips will focus on a broader range of products including tablets, Ultrabooks, and phones. The two companies are also targeting access points, residential gateways, and media center devices.
